BIOLOGY is certainly a Gram-negative obligate intracellular bacterium, and chlamydial types have the ability to infect both human beings (and (15). Some serovars normally infect the attention (serovars A to C), while some infect mainly genital tissue (serovars D to K) (16). In the genital tissue, normally infects the cervical (females) or urethral (guys) epithelium level (17). is available in two developmental forms: the primary body (EB), which is certainly infectious, nonreplicating, and extracellular; as well as the reticulate body (RB), which is certainly non-infectious, replicating, and intracellular. The EB shows no metabolic activity and can survive for very long periods beyond your cell. Infection starts when the tiny (0.2 MX1013 to 0.3 m) EB is certainly internalized with the cell. After 8 to 10 h, the vesicle-bound EB (termed an addition) replicates by binary fission in to the bigger (0.8 m) RB (18). After replication, the RBs revert back again p21-Rac1 to EBs, which have the ability to infect neighboring cells (19). can avoid devastation by stopping lysosomal fusion and replicating within an addition beyond your endocytic pathway (18).
